How far is Norton Shores, MI from Grand Rapids, MI?

Distance by Flight

Shortest distance between Norton Shores and Grand Rapids is 33.26 miles (53.53 km).

Flight distance from Norton Shores, MI to Grand Rapids, MI is 33.26 miles. Estimated flight time is 00 hours 04 minutes.

Driving distance

The driving distance from Norton Shores, Michigan to Grand Rapids, Michigan is: 39.11 miles (62.94 km) by car.

Driving from Norton Shores to Grand Rapids will take approximately 00 hours 41 minutes.

#2 Grand Rapids

The second most populous city in Michigan. It is located in the western part of the state. Grand Rapids is known for its many breweries, its many parks and green spaces, and its many attractions, such as the Frederik Meijer Gardens & Sculpture Park and the Grand Rapids Art Museum.
